Misty Double Glazing Repairs

Double glazing that is misted is a problem that is common and can be expensive to fix. It is usually caused by a leak in the seal that allows moisture to penetrate and affect the insulation properties of the window panes.

Avoiding extreme temperature fluctuations and ensuring your windows are maintained will help you avoid this issue. It is crucial to take care of the issue when it first appears.

Repair of the Seal

Misty double glazing repairs are a common issue for many people who have double-glazed windows. Double-glazed windows have an airtight seal that is between two panes. This assists in controlling the temperature in a building or room. When the seals get damaged, it can cause problems like draughts, condensation, and loss of energy. If these issues aren't addressed, they can become costly to fix. Fortunately, there are ways to fix this issue without replacing the entire double-glazed unit.

The most important component of a double-glazed window that holds the two panes of glass together is the Hot Melt Sealant. This sealant is able to keep the two glass panes in place, however, it only lasts for a limited period of time before it becomes damaged or wears out. Once the Hot-Melt Sealant breaks down, moisture will begin to accumulate between the glass panes of the window, which causes it to turn misty.

This happens most often when windows with double glazing are used to cool or dry clothes. These activities can lead to condensation developing inside of the window. This will then create fogging. A sudden temperature change can also cause this. This can result in the window developing cracks or leak, which will let moisture in the insulation.

Many people believe that placing heated air between the two glass panes will resolve the misting issue, but this is not the case. This method creates warm air into the gap which is not the ideal outcome. It can also worsen the windows that have been blown as the anti-moisture grain in the spacer bars are soaked with water.

Replacement of Windows

A misty window is a sign that your double glazing was not sealed and insulated properly. This can cause heat to escape and raise the cost of heating. The moisture has entered the window because the insulation gases have been broken down. This causes warm air to rise and cool air sink - which results in condensation.

This can be fixed by replacing the double-glazed window. It is usually cheaper to replace the double-glazed unit instead of to replace the entire window. This is a more permanent solution. This is a good idea prior to winter, as a broken window can cause your heating system work harder than it needs to.

Some companies claim they can repair misted windows without the need to replace them. They do this by drilling holes into the window and then using chemicals to soak out the moisture. This is messy and difficult to do on toughened glass. Furthermore, it is not a permanent solution, and windows are likely to become misty once again.

The frame seal is the best method to fix a double-glazed windows that is misty. This will stop condensation and draughts from causing problems in the future. A professional will be able complete the task quickly and efficiently.

A professional can also fix double-glazed windows that are difficult to open and close. This could be due to various factors, such as the hinges being damaged or the gaskets being worn down. They can be easily fixed by an expert and are usually cheaper than replacing the entire window.
